LoRa技术及通信模块接口控制介绍

LoRa技术(Long Range Radio)是一种基于扩频技术的超远距离无线传输技术,主要由美国Semtech公司开发和推广。LoRa技术的核心优势在于其能够在低功耗条件下实现远距离传输,这解决了传统低功耗设备传输距离短的问题。

  一、 LoRa技术介绍

  1. LoRa技术原理

  LoRa技术利用扩频调制技术,通过改变信号的扩展因子和码率来实现长距离传输和低功耗特性。具体来说,LoRa技术通过在较低频率范围内传输信号,利用扩频技术的特点,实现了长距离的无线通信。

  2. 应用场景

  LoRa技术因其低功耗、远距离传输和灵活的组网能力,被广泛应用于物联网、智能家居、工业控制等领域。例如,在智慧社区、智能家居和楼宇、智能表计、智慧农业、智能物流等多个垂直行业中都有广泛的应用。

  3. 通信模块接口控制

LoRa模块通常提供多种通信接口,如串口(TXD/RXD)、SPI、I2C等。根据所选用的单片机类型,可以选择合适的通信接口进行连接。例如,如果使用STM32单片机,可以通过串口进行数据传输。

  4. 接线方式

  • 直接接线:将LoRa模块的引脚直接与其他电子设备的引脚相连。
  • 使用接口板:通过接口板将LoRa模块与其他电子设备连接,这种方式更为灵活和方便。

  5. 具体步骤

  • 硬件连接:首先需要明确LoRa模块和单片机之间的通信接口,然后将LoRa模块通过适当的接口连接到单片机上,确保两者能够进行通信。
  • 电平匹配:由于LoRa模块的对外接口电平为3.3V TTL电平信号,而单片机的UART口通常是+5V表示1.0V表示0的TTL电平标准,可能需要增加电平转换器来实现电平匹配。
  • 参数配置:配置LoRa模块的参数,如频率、功率、编码等,以确保通信的稳定性和可靠性。

  6. 常见LoRa模块

  市场上常见的LoRa模块包括SX1278、E22-900T22U等。这些模块具有不同的功能和接口选项,适用于各种LoRa应用场景。例如,SX1278模块支持UART串口通信接口、USB接口、小体积、远距离、低功耗等特点。

  7. 总结

  LoRa技术通过其独特的扩频调制技术,实现了低功耗和远距离传输的统一,广泛应用于物联网和智能设备领域。LoRa模块通过多种通信接口与单片机或其他电子设备连接,用户可以根据具体需求选择合适的接口和配置参数,以实现高效稳定的通信。

  二、 LoRa技术在物联网领域的最新应用趋势是什么?

  LoRa技术在物联网领域的最新应用趋势主要体现在以下几个方面:

  • 行业应用深入:LoRa技术已经从早期的抄表类应用扩展到智慧城市、智慧农业、消费烟感、智能家居等多个领域,应用市场呈现出蓬勃发展的态势。未来,LoRa技术将进一步深入各行各业,推动更多行业的数字化转型。
  • 终端设备多样化:随着技术的不断进步和市场需求的增加,LoRa技术将支持更多种类的终端设备,以满足不同场景下的需求。
  • 技术升级改进:LoRa技术将继续进行技术升级和改进,以提高其性能和可靠性。这包括长距离传输、低功耗、低成本和高可靠性等特点的进一步优化。
  • 与其他技术的融合应用:LoRa技术将与5G、人工智能(AI)等先进技术进行融合应用,进一步拓展其应用场景,推动物联网市场的健康发展。
  • 向LoRaLAN发展:虽然LoRa技术仍然会保留其原有的优势,但未来将向LoRaLAN方向发展,以适应更广泛的室内外应用场景,如智能楼宇、智能小区、智能家居和智慧办公等。
  • 政策支持加强:政府对LoRa技术的支持也在不断加强,这将有助于推动LoRa技术在国内外市场的进一步发展。
  • 国际合作拓展:随着全球物联网市场的不断扩大,LoRa技术也将在国际合作中发挥重要作用,推动全球物联网生态系统的建设。

  LoRa技术在物联网领域的最新应用趋势包括行业应用的深入、终端设备的多样化、技术的升级改进、与其他技术的融合应用、向LoRaLAN的发展以及政策支持和国际合作的加强。

  三、 LoRa模块与其他低功耗通信技术(如Sigfox、NB-IoT)的性能比较如何?

  LoRa模块与其他低功耗通信技术(如Sigfox、NB-IoT)的性能比较如下:

信号带宽

  LoRa和NB-IoT的信号带宽明显高于Sigfox,后者工作频率为0.1 KHz。

所需网关

  LoRa需要专用网关才能工作,而NB-IoT则不需要。NB-IoT的基础设施是直接连接基站和传感器设立的,LoRa架构需要通过网关来进行数据传输。

功耗和电池寿命

  NB-IoT被认为是设计用于LPWAN的最优低功耗标准,具有经过实践验证的10-15年以上的电池寿命。而LoRaWAN则是大规模物联网应用的最佳选择。

  LoRa的功耗差距主要在于端到端的架构和推广方式,而不是单纯的芯片和模块之间的能源性能差距。要达到与LoRaWAN网络相当的能耗性能,NB-IoT需要突破10个挑战。

数据传输速率

  NB-IoT的数据传输速率理论上可以达到160Kbps-250Kbps,而LoRa的通讯速率约为0.3-50Kbps。在这方面,NB-IoT可能会让LoRa退出游戏。

覆盖范围

  LoRa具有较高的渗透能力,可以穿透地下室数层,覆盖范围为3-5米。

成本

  Sigfox的无线电模块成本最低(不到$5),相比之下,LoRa的成本约为$10.NB-IoT的成本为$12.

适用场景

  NB-IoT适用于对连接稳定性和功耗要求较高的场景,而LoRa更适用于远距离通信和低功耗长寿命的应用。

  LoRa模块在某些方面(如覆盖范围和低功耗)具有优势,但在数据传输速率和成本方面可能不如NB-IoT和Sigfox。

  四、 如何解决LoRa模块电平匹配问题

  解决LoRa模块电平匹配问题,特别是在不同电压环境下的解决方案,可以从以下几个方面进行考虑:

  一些LoRa模块配备了自动电压适应功能,用户无需跳线选择不同的输入电压。例如,某些电源模块在发生短路时会自动关断,以避免硬件损坏。

  选择工作电压范围较宽的LoRa芯片可以提高其适应性。例如,TP1107芯片的工作电压范围为2.5V至3.6V,这使得它能够在不同的电压环境下正常工作。

  一些LoRa模块允许通过串口指令或专用工具进行配置,以适应不同的供电电压。例如,ZLSN9700C模块可以通过串口指令或ZLVircom工具配置供电电压为5V或3.3V。

  保证供电电源的电压稳定性是非常重要的,因为电压的大幅频繁波动可能会导致模块损坏。

  根据不同的LoRa模块推荐的电压范围选择合适的供电方式。例如,F8L10D-N推荐使用DC 3.3V/0.5A,而F8L10D-E推荐使用DC 5V/1A。这些模块的工作电压范围分别为DC 3.3~5V和DC 3.3~5V。

  对于功耗较低的应用场景,可以使用锂亚电池(如ER14505M和10Ah 3.6V锂亚电池)来供电,这种方式可以实现长时间的供电。

  在某些情况下,电源电压的变化可能会对输出功率和接收性能产生影响。例如,F8L10D-E模块在电源电压小于4V时,输出功率会有所下降,但对接收性能影响很小。

  五、 LoRa技术在智能家居领域的具体应用案例有哪些?

  LoRa技术在智能家居领域的具体应用案例包括以下几个方面:

  • 远程监控和控制系统:LoRa技术可以应用于智能家居中的远程监控和控制系统,实现家庭设备和系统的智能化控制。
  • 温控器:LoRa无线模块在温控器中的应用实例中,温控器与网关之间的通信采用LoRa无线模块ZM470SX-M,该模块具备低功耗、远距离等特性,适用于埋墙等方式的应用。
  • 智能传感器:LoRa无线通信节点可以是各种智能传感器,如烟雾传感器、水表、气表等,这些设备通过LoRa技术实现远程数据传输和监控。

  这些案例展示了LoRa技术在智能家居领域的广泛应用,特别是在远程监控、控制系统以及智能传感器等方面。

  六、 LoRa模块的能耗优化策略有哪些,以实现更长距离传输?

  LoRa模块的能耗优化策略主要包括以下几个方面,以实现更长距离传输:

  • 降低发射功率:通过调整发射功率,可以有效提高传输距离。例如,将发射功率从14dBm提高到20dBm,可以使通信距离延长到原来的2倍。
  • 睡眠模式功耗极低:LoRa模块可以采用多级休眠和空中唤醒技术,关闭不需要的外设,从而在超低功耗下实现超长距离传输。
  • 合理设置数据发送周期:防止长时间收发,避免不必要的功耗消耗。
  • 设置低功耗接收模式:如深度睡眠唤醒定时检测信道,可以进一步降低功耗。
  • 选择低功耗MCU平台:例如使用ARM等低功耗处理器,可以有效降低整个系统的功耗。
  • 优化通信速率:LoRa采用长距离、低速率传输,相比于高速率传输,能够减少信号传输的功耗。
  • 选择适当的工作频率:不同的工作频率对传输距离和功耗有不同的影响,选择合适的频率可以最大化通信距离。
  • 加密和纠错码:通过加密和纠错码可以提高数据传输的可靠性,从而减少重传次数,进一步降低功耗。
  • 选用合适的天线:选择合适的天线(如直立式板天线、螺旋天线、磁贴天线等)可以大幅提高传输距离。
  • 提高天线高度:天线高度越高,传输的障碍物也就越少,可以进一步提高传输距离。

原创声明:文章来自技象科技,如欲转载,请注明本文链接://www.viralrail.com/blog/94118.html

免费咨询组网方案
Baidu
map